What Is Qi Men Dun Jia?
Qi Men Dun Jia, or QMDJ, is one of the most advanced systems in Chinese Metaphysics. It started as a military strategy tool over three thousand years ago. Emperors used it to time battles and alliances. Over the centuries, it moved from the battlefield into civilian life, and today it is applied to business decisions, career choices, and everyday situations where timing and conditions matter.
What is Qi Men Dun Jia?
The name translates roughly to “Mysterious Gate Escaping Technique.” At its core, QMDJ uses a chart with multiple layers to analyse the conditions around a specific question. Unlike systems that focus on personality or destiny alone, QMDJ looks at the dynamic conditions of a moment. That is what makes it so well suited to business strategy and decision making.
The History of Qi Men Dun Jia
The system traces back over three thousand years. It was originally a military tool, used by emperors and their advisors to decide when to fight, when to negotiate, and when to wait. As dynasties rose and fell, the system was refined and gradually adapted for civilian use.
How Does Qi Men Dun Jia Work?
A QMDJ chart is cast at a specific moment in time. It maps the positions of stems, doors, stars, deities, and palaces across a grid. Each layer tells you something different about the situation. By reading how those layers interact, a practitioner can see the conditions, challenges, and opportunities present at that moment.
The Qi Men Dun Jia Chart
The chart is where everything happens. It is a grid of nine palaces, each filled with specific stems, doors, stars, and deities. The chart is built from the time and date of the question or event you are analysing. Learning to read it is the first real step in understanding QMDJ.
The 8 Doors
The Eight Doors (八门) are one of the most important parts of a QMDJ chart. Each door represents a different kind of energy, from highly favourable to challenging. They tell you the nature of the opportunity or obstacle in a given palace.
The 9 Stars
The Nine Stars (九星) bring celestial influences into the chart. Each star has its own character and meaning, adding another layer to the reading. They interact with the doors and stems to give you a fuller picture of what is happening in a situation.
The 8 Deities
The Eight Deities (八神) represent subtle energetic influences. They often reveal hidden factors that the doors and stars alone might not show. Each deity has a distinct role, and learning to read them adds real depth to your interpretation.
The 9 Palaces
The Nine Palaces (九宫) form the structural grid of the chart. Each palace corresponds to a direction and holds a specific combination of stems, doors, stars, and deities. Everything else in the system lives inside these palaces.
The Heavenly Stems
The Heavenly Stems (天干) appear across many Chinese Metaphysics systems, including QMDJ. There are ten stems, each with unique properties. In the chart, they represent specific energies and conditions within each palace.

Explore the Systems of Chinese Metaphysics
Each system offers a different lens on life, business, and decisions. Understanding how they differ is what makes them useful.
1. Qi Men Dun Jia
The primary system I teach and practise. A strategic tool for examining timing, circumstances, opportunities, people, and decisions. The most dynamic and action-oriented system in Chinese Metaphysics.
2. Zi Wei Dou Shu
Sometimes called Purple Star Astrology. A system for understanding life patterns, characteristics, relationships, and major stages from your birth data.
3. BaZi Reading
Built from your birth date and time. Analyses the balance of elements to reveal personality, strengths, weaknesses, and life patterns. Especially useful for understanding people in business.
4. I Ching
The Book of Changes. One of the oldest Chinese systems for understanding change itself. Uses 64 hexagrams to represent different states of transformation.
5. Feng Shui for Business
The system that looks at the relationship between people and their environment. In business, that means examining how your office, premises, and workspace influence outcomes.
Integrating Chinese Metaphysics for Business
Different systems serve different purposes. Not every system fits every question. The value comes from knowing which one is right for the question in front of you.
Key Takeaway
The value of Chinese Metaphysics is not in any single system. It is in knowing which tool to reach for, and when. QMDJ for timing and strategy. BaZi for people. Feng Shui for environment. Each answers a different question.
| System | What It Sees |
|---|---|
| Qi Men Dun Jia | Strategy, timing & decisions |
| Zi Wei Dou Shu | Life patterns & destiny |
| BaZi | Personal characteristics & life cycles |
| I Ching | Change & decision-making |
| Feng Shui | Environment & space |
If the question is about timing for a business launch, QMDJ is the most directly applicable system. If you want to understand the long-term patterns of a business partnership, BaZi or Zi Wei Dou Shu may give you deeper insight. If the question is about the physical environment of a new office, Feng Shui is the right tool.
